Exhibition in Your Libraries: The Countries of the 2026 World Cup
The exhibition "The Countries of the World Cup" offers a journey across cultures that bring football to life. Fun and colorful, it highlights the countries participating in the upcoming World Cup, allowing visitors young and old to locate each country on the map, learn key facts and discover their identity. Enhanced with information sheets about iconic animals, traditions, famous figures and culinary specialties, each country is also represented by a mascot created by Belgian illustrator Laura Parisse. An opportunity to discover traditional dances, typical recipes or remarkable personalities.
Good to know
In partnership with the Fédération Wallonie-Bruxelles, the Province of Luxembourg and the City of Aubange. Free access during library opening hours. Activities for primary and secondary classes (duration: 1h to 1h30) with an adapted "Trivial Pursuit" game.
